GamesRadar: Clash of Ninja Revolution 3 Review

Anyone familiar with fighting games can find something here. That obnoxious orange ninja will inevitably put off many people, but don't follow their lead. Take a chance here. Clash of Ninja Revolution 3 is a different yet enjoyable fighting game. Your friends might hassle you, but it's their loss.

Read Full Story >>
The story is too old to be commented.